What exactly are Montessori Educational institutions?


Montessori colleges are based on the academic philosophy and solutions made by Dr. Maria Montessori, an Italian medical professional and educator. Inside the early 1900s, Montessori began her do the job with young children who had been thought of uneducable at time. As a result of watchful observation and experimentation, she developed a youngster-centered method that emphasizes independence, liberty inside of restrictions, and respect for a child’s natural psychological, Bodily, and social enhancement.

Nowadays, Montessori schools can be found everywhere in the globe, serving kids from infancy through adolescence. The hallmark of those colleges is usually a Finding out atmosphere that encourages kids to discover and study at their own individual tempo, fostering a love of Finding out which can last a life time.

The Montessori Strategy: Main Concepts


Montessori education and learning is guided by various key rules that notify the look of Montessori colleges as well as the tactic of educators within them:

  • Kid-Centered Understanding: Montessori lecture rooms are built within the desires of the kids, making it possible for them to get charge of their very own learning.

  • Geared up Surroundings: The classroom is diligently organized with supplies and activities which might be accessible and inviting to small children. This natural environment is supposed to motivate exploration and discovery.

  • Fingers-On Learning: Little ones find out by accomplishing, making use of a wide range of academic materials which might be made to be self-correcting and to teach unique expertise or principles.

  • Blended Age Groups: Montessori school rooms usually comprise a mixture of ages, allowing for young small children to master from more mature peers and older small children to strengthen their learning by instructing ideas they've now mastered.

  • Guided Freedom: Throughout the prepared ecosystem, kids have the liberty to choose their pursuits, whilst the Instructor guides and facilitates the educational system.


Montessori Classroom Dynamics


Walk into a Montessori classroom, and you could be amazed by Whatever you see—or somewhat, what you don't see. There won't be any rows of desks struggling with a Trainer with the entrance on the place. Instead, kids are sometimes observed Performing independently or in smaller groups, engaged in many different duties, from sorting colored beads to practising cursive producing on sandpaper letters.

The Instructor, generally generally known as a guide, moves quietly amongst the children, providing assistance as desired but mostly permitting learners to direct their own Mastering. The aim is never to fill youngsters with points and figures but to cultivate their organic want to learn and to help you them develop the skills they should do this correctly.

Vital Factors of the Montessori Education


Montessori education is distinctive in its approach to training and learning. Here are some of The important thing components which make Montessori schools distinctive:

  • Specifically Intended Elements: Montessori components are didactic, which means They are intended to educate specific classes. They usually have a sensorial foundation, assisting children to be aware of abstract ideas by partaking their senses.

  • Focus on Daily life Skills: Simple existence functions really are a staple of Montessori schooling, training children each day capabilities like pouring, sweeping, and tying shoelaces. These functions are not just about the talents them selves but about developing focus, coordination, and independence.

  • Emphasis on Peace and World Citizenship: Montessori universities normally integrate lessons about peace, cultural range, as well as interconnectedness of all lifetime, Along with the goal of fostering empathy and international recognition.

  • Assessment As a result of Observation: In lieu of relying on checks and grades, Montessori academics assess kid's progress as a result of watchful observation and individualized monitoring of their achievements.
